服务器长时间运行后出现卡顿现象,怎么解决?
在服务器长时间运行后,有时候会出现卡顿现象,导致服务器无法正常运行,影响工作效率。本文从四个方面介绍如何解决服务器长时间运行后的卡顿现象,帮助管理员更好地维护服务器的稳定性。
1、硬件问题
服务器长时间使用容易导致硬件(如CPU、内存、硬盘)过热、老化、损坏等问题,进而导致服务器卡顿。解决办法如下:(1)定期清洁和保养服务器,清除灰尘、加强散热,保证硬件处于良好状态。
(2)更新服务器硬件,比如更换散热器、添加或更换硬盘、升级内存等,提升服务器性能。
(3)采用负载均衡技术,将压力分配到多台服务器上,减轻单台服务器的压力。
2、系统问题
服务器长时间运行后,操作系统会产生各种问题,如进程卡死、内存泄漏等,进而导致服务器卡顿。解决办法如下:(1)定期清理无用进程和程序,释放内存资源。
(2)安装并使用性能监控工具,实时监控服务器运行状态,及时发现问题并处理。
(3)规定定期系统重新启动时间,以便更新和修复操作系统。
3、网络问题
服务器长时间运行后,可能会出现网络拥堵、丢包等问题,导致服务器通信延迟,进而导致卡顿。解决办法如下:(1)检查网络连接,确保网络连接正常。
(2)合理分配网络带宽资源,避免某个应用占用大量网络带宽,导致其他应用卡顿。
(3)采用负载均衡技术,将访问请求分发到多台服务器上,减轻单台服务器的负担。
4、应用问题
服务器上的应用程序长时间运行后,可能会出现资源泄漏、内存溢出等问题,导致服务器出现卡顿现象。解决办法如下:(1)合理编写应用程序,加强内存资源管理。
(2)优化应用程序I/O操作,减少输入输出次数。
(3)确保应用程序之间资源隔离,避免单个应用程序影响其他应用程序运行。
综上所述,使用以下方法可以有效解决服务器长时间运行后出现的卡顿问题:
(1)定期清洁和保养服务器,更新硬件硬件设备;
(2)通过安装性能监控工具,及时发现和处理操作系统问题;
(3)合理分配网络带宽资源,避免网络拥堵问题的出现;
(4)优化应用程序,确保应用程序之间资源隔离。
通过这些措施,可以确保服务器的稳定性和可靠性,避免服务器长时间运行后出现卡顿现象,提高工作效率。
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!